Trekking the Monasteries of Tibet
Guru Rimpoche, the Red hats, and the Yellow Hats!
Your journey begins where Buddhism
began in Tibet - the Tsetang region, east
of Lhasa. Explore one of the oldest
Nyingma-pa monasteries, Samye - a
model of the Buddhist universe, and the
meditation caves that served the likes of
Guru Rimpoche and the 5th Dalai Lama.
The trail, with lakes, meadows, tiny
villages, and nomad camps takes you to
the holy Guru Rimpoche cave of Chimpu.
Stop at Lake Nam Tso, spend two nights in
Reteng, then stop at Ganden on your way
back to Lhasa. This is a trip of monks,
monasteries and more salt tea than you
imagined possible.
